Ruckus Wireless, now part of Brocade, has announced Ola Cabs has deployed a fast and reliable Ruckus Smart Wi-Fi network to improve and grow its cab network in India.
Ola Cabs is an online cab aggregator, providing a range of cab services from economy to luxury travel, and has a network of over 200,000 cars across 85 cities. As Ola Cabs continued its growth in India, it needed to ensure it could on-board new cars as quickly as possible at its attachment centres. However, Ola’s employees were experiencing connectivity issues when trying to attach new cabs to the network using the legacy 3G cellular connection.
“When a new driver or vehicle owner wants to join our transport network, we need to complete an operational and functional level audit to ensure the vehicles pass our requirements to validate their roadworthiness and are of an appropriate standard,” explained Shwetank Singh, network and infrastructure engineer at Ola Cabs. “The problem was, the 3G wireless connection we typically use to support our token management system was not providing the speed and reliability we were expecting for connecting to our main server. Signal dropouts, interference and limited range were commonplace, creating frustration amongst staff and drivers, as well as slowing down the attachment process.”
Ola Cabs reached out to 3in IT Solutions to find a solution that offered the performance, security, ease of management, coverage and reliability required to overcome the challenges in the cab attachment process.
“What really stood out during the testing phase was Ruckus’ patented smart antenna technologies. Its adaptive antenna was a real advantage, particularly over omnidirectional antennas, as it provided greater connectivity, performance and stability, while reducing interference on the network,” explained Singh.
Ola Cabs has deployed Ruckus ZoneFlex T301 dual-band 802.11ac outdoor APs across its outdoor cab attachment areas to support all the staff using tablets and laptops to log cab attachments. ZoneFlex T301 APs enable focussed Wi-Fi coverage in the most challenging outdoor environments by mitigating interference and providing unmatched capacity and reliability, through the Ruckus patented BeamFlex technology.
“The key to success of the installation is our patented BeamFlex Smart Wi-Fi antenna array technology. It monitors the environment and dynamically adjusts the signal to the best performing path, automatically steering around interference and obstacles,” said Sudarshan Boosupalli, Managing Director, Ruckus Wireless India & SAARC. “This ensures the strongest signal, highest throughput and least interference, enabling Ola Cabs staff to on-board vehicles over the Wi-Fi network quickly and efficiently, without the fear of dropouts.”
Ola Cabs has also deployed the Ruckus ZoneDirecto 1200 to centrally manage its Wi-Fi network. The ZoneDirector 1200 can be deployed and operated by non-wireless experts and installed quickly and easily. It has been specifically designed for small-to-medium enterprises (SMEs) with limited IT staff and budget, enabling them to create a robust and secure multimedia WLAN in a matter of minutes.
